Creating a Safe Learning Environment

This method focuses on establishing guidelines for creating a safe, inclusive, and open collaborative space. It ensures that all participants feel comfortable sharing their ideas and perspectives without fear of judgment or criticism.

When to use Creating a Safe Learning Environment

Use this method at the beginning of any collaborative activity to establish a foundation of trust and respect.

What it solves

Lack of psychological safety, fear of speaking up, dominant voices drowning out quiet participants, unproductive conflict.

How to run Creating a Safe Learning Environment, step by step

  1. Facilitate a group discussion on the importance of psychological safety in collaborative settings. (5 mins)
  2. Brainstorm guidelines for creating a safe, inclusive, and open collaborative space. (15 mins)
  3. Review and refine the guidelines as a group, ensuring that everyone agrees on the final version. (10 mins)

Materials needed

  • Whiteboard or flip chart
  • Markers or pens

Facilitator tips

  • Encourage participants to share their personal experiences and perspectives on psychological safety.
  • Use examples of positive and negative behaviors to illustrate the importance of the guidelines.

Common pitfalls

  • Participants are hesitant to share their concerns about psychological safety.
  • The guidelines are too vague or general to be effective.

Variations

  • Use pre-defined guidelines as a starting point for the discussion.
  • Involve participants in creating visual representations of the guidelines.

Running it online or hybrid

Use a shared online document or whiteboard to collaboratively create and agree on guidelines.

What it produces

A set of agreed-upon guidelines for creating a safe learning environment.
